Преподаватели в курса
  
Цветомир Цанов - Занимава с програмиране и алгоритми от няколко години насам. Водил е курсове и обучения в Софтуерния университет, където успява да обясни трудна материя с прости примери и много търпение. Цветомир се вдъхновява от сървърно програмиране, операционни системи и паралелни изчисления. Най-важният въпрос за него е "как работят нещата отвътре" и това го движи към непрестанно четене, пробване, ръчкане и накрая - обяснение с прости думи.

Иван Иванов - програмист и преподавател по призвание. Завършил е софтуерната академия на Телерик и оттогава работи като freelancer и води обучения за софтуерни инженери. Обича да се бори с трудни задачи и да предлага елегантни решения. Ученето на нови технологии му е ежедневие. Освен програмирането и алгоритмите, другата му страст е да изучава квантова физика и нейните закони.

Теодор Вълчев - Занимава  се професионално с програмиране от 2007, като основно работи на PHP, Python, JS, MongoDB и постоянно следи тенденциите в технологичният свят. Автор на уроци по програмиране, обучителни програми и консултант. Любител на отворения код и въпросите без ясен отговор.

Пълна анотация на курса

Курсът има за цел да запознае студентите с основните техники на откриване и отстраняване на проблеми при писането на C++ код. За да се извлече максимална полза от курса е необходимо студентите да имат опит с програмирането на C++. За целите на курса, главно ще се използва MS Visual Studio, но показаните техники могат успешно да се приложат и за други среди за разработка.

Очаквани резултати от обучението

Курсът ще предостави нужните насоки и знания към ефективното дебъгване , чрез което участиниците в курса ще могат успешно да разберът и поправят бъговете и в най-заплетените ситуации.Защото разликата между успешния и посредствения програмист е крие в коректното дебъгване.

Учебно съдържание

  1. Тема 1: Основни методи за дебъгване
  2. Тема 2: Използване на VS Debbuger
  3. Тема 3: Алтернативни методи за дебъгване.
Предварителни изисквания
    
Преминаване на входящия тест.
  
Времеви график

Седмица

(от дата до дата)

Тема

Задания

Срок за предаване

15.02.2016 – 21.03.2016

Тема 1: Основни методи на дебъгване

Задание 1

21.03.2016

22.03.2016 – 28.05.2016

Тема 2: Използване на VS Debugger

Задание 2

28.05.2016

1.06.2016 – 25.06.2016

Тема 3: Алтернативни методи за дебъгване

Задание 3


15.10.2016






Присъствените занянитя за курса ще се проведат на:

  • Всеки понеделник от 16 ч. до 18 ч. в зала 325
  • Всяка сряда от 16 ч. до 18ч. в зала 325
Оценяване
  

За успешното вземане на курса всеки студент трябва да събере минимум 60 точки.


Скала за оценки:

  • 60 точки - Среден 3
  • 70 точки - Добър 4
  • 80 точки - Много добър 5
  • 90 точки - Отличен 6

Следния брой точки се дават за всяко от следните:
  • 2 теста по 35 точки всеки;
  • 3 задания за домашна работа по 10 точки всяко;
  • По 5 точки за всеки разрешен казус или тема в която се споделя решението на проблем във форума.


Литература

Best solutions for Debugging - Marco Lewandovski & Robert Reus.

Most common mistakes in Debugging - Jamie Mahrez & Rijad Vardy.

Using Visual Studio Debbuger - Alexis Mertesaker & Peter Sanches & Per Cech.


Последно модифициране: вторник, 11 февруари 2016, 09:47

Последно модифициране: сряда, 31 август 2016, 19:49